Rate Schedules menus, control keys, and icons
The Rate Schedules menu bar is located at the top of the Edit Settlement Rate Schedule Folder. Each menu lists selections that allow you to perform tasks within the Rate Schedules application. Many tasks can also be initiated using control keys and/or by the icons shown in the sheet toolbar.
The following table lists Rate Schedules menu commands that are available when a pay rate is in view, as well as the commands’ control keys and icons.
Options on the Custom menu depend on your company's setup.
